Frequent Technical Challenges and Their Simple Resolutions

Sometimes a browser game runs sluggishly or fails to start, and the culprit is typically cache buildup or a browser extension blocking scripts. We suggest removing cached images and files from the past month, a 30-second operation in privacy settings that releases memory without erasing saved passwords. Ad-blockers and script-blocking extensions, useful for general browsing, can confuse game logic scripts for trackers and block them. Creating a quick whitelist rule for the casino domain fixes that right away. Another common cause is an outdated graphics driver, which prevents WebGL from kicking in. A free driver update, particularly on older Windows laptops with manufacturer-specific GPU utilities, often lifts performance from unplayable to flawless.

If you’re on a corporate or campus network, firewall policies might limit non-standard ports used by live streaming. Switch to a standard HTTPS port in the browser or use a mobile hotspot to determine if the issue is network-specific. We also find players with aggressively customized privacy configurations that block local storage entirely. A few kilobytes of local storage are necessary to remember session identifiers and layout preferences; denying that permission altogether throws the game into a crippled state. Resetting privacy settings to a balanced ‘standard’ mode and activating session cookies restores full functionality. If a game still flickers or shows corrupted textures, toggle hardware acceleration off and back on. That causes the browser to rebuild the render pipeline, clearing most residual graphical glitches in under ten seconds.

Security Perks of Browser-Based Play

Sticking to browser-only play has a compelling security argument: digital hygiene and threat reduction. Every bit of installed software introduces a risk surface. Downloadable executables from unverified sources can be swapped for malicious clones by shady distribution sites. Operating entirely inside a modern browser’s sandboxed environment greatly limits a bad actor’s ability to reach your file system or capture keystrokes. At Drakaris Casino, we require an HTTPS connection with TLS encryption on every page, establishing a shielded tunnel that prevents man-in-the-middle attacks on open Wi-Fi. This keeps your login details and financial transactions secured and unreadable to anyone intercepting packets at a coffee shop or airport lounge.

Browser-based platforms also benefit from the auto-updating nature of Chrome and Firefox. When a zero-day vulnerability affects a browser engine, Google and Mozilla usually resolve it within hours, and the fix deploys silently without any necessity for a new casino installer. A native Windows client, on the other hand, might go unpatched for months while a player ignores update prompts, leaving a hole in their defenses. We also apply strict server-side RNG verification for every instant-play title, so the game outcome never reaches your local machine. That makes client-side memory manipulation tools useless; the authoritative result is produced, logged, and signed on secure hardware far from any local influence.

In what manner Instant-Play Loading Mechanisms Actually Work

When you select a game tile, your browser initiates a secure handshake with the casino’s content delivery network, a geographically distributed group of servers built to minimize latency. Rather than pulling the full multi-gigabyte game file at once, the system delivers assets progressively, prioritizing the spin interface and critical audio cues so you can start playing right away. We’ve built the platform to cache just the game’s shell locally, so the next time you launch that title, it starts almost instantly. This process hinges on compressed texture packages and efficient memory management inside the browser tab. If you were to watch the network traffic, you’d see that the game never quits fetching extra assets as you play; it fetches bonus round animations or rarely seen symbols in the background while your current spin finishes.

The majority of modern browser games employ a technique called lazy loading for features not needed right away. Soundtracks for free-spin rounds and complex 3D particle effects for jackpot celebrations remain dormant until the game logic initiates them. This approach keeps RAM usage low, especially useful for Canadian players multitasking with several tabs open. We know internet stability varies across the country, from fibre connections in downtown Toronto to satellite links in rural areas. So the streaming protocol modifies bitrate on the fly, trading a bit of animation smoothness to avoid a complete freeze. If your connection drops momentarily during a spin, the server retains the bet instruction and finishes the outcome independently, then displays the result the instant connectivity comes back.
